They were a very nice family, but complete novices..

Husband, wife and 2 young sons under 10.
They had decided to take an unmarked road road across a mountain pass that they though to be 25kms,(locals told them) but was in fact closer to 120kms. They had no maps, no GPS and no idea where they were.

Battery was flat as they had been there for 6 hours and their two young sons were watching DVD's plugged into a 1500w inverter. Stopped running the engine as they were very low on fuel after running for 3 hours to keep the boys entertained. Battery went dead in about 40mins thereafter.

They had no food, 2lts of warm water and I was the first person ( and I guess the only person that day) to drive that route.

He didn't think to carry a jack as he had fitted BFG AT tyres before he left Spain and was told they would never have to worry about a puncture with those tyres.( and there was no room after his wife packed half her shoe cupboard)

The wife begged us to travel in convoy with them as the experience had really frightened them.

The route was like this for about another 60kms

IMG_0202_2.jpg


They were extremely grateful and they invited us to stay at their villa in Marbella for a week, put on a great party for us, introduced us to all their friends and family.

You can imagine the ribbing they got for the remainder of the trip about their rubbish RR and merits of the mighty LC.

He was amazed at the gear on the truck from the water/food/tent/ to the on board air etc etc etc.. just kept saying you could have stayed there for a week without a problem and we were panicking after 2 hours...

Anyway we made some good friends and they want to do another trip, this time with more preparation... he warned me that the next time hs car will be a real G4 RR!!!

That's a great story and some good lessons for all of us. Seems hard to believe that someone would jeopardise their family's lives by running down their fuel and then their only means of restarting their (auto) car simply to entertain their kids :shock: At worst with the flat tyre and no spare, they could have locked the centre diff and just driven on until the rim was gone. But no battery juice and that option disappeared too....
